I installed TSO on my 32 bit system, no Maxis products were found. Also no manifest.

interesting... the "No Maxis products found" Error is caused by the registry on 64bit Systems... can you tell me where your Maxis\The Sims Online Entry is in your registry? It should be under H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E->SOFTWARE->Maxis->The Sims Online

thanks i found it

so what do i do mine is hkey_local_machine/software/wow6432node/maxis/the sims online

do i delete this or move them to stop the error

don't delete it! Just right click on the sims online, click on export and save it (easiest way is to save it to your desktop), if that is done close the registry editor (the regedit program) and on your desktop (or where ever you saved the file earlier) right click on it and choose edit. That should open Notepad, in Notepad you just delete the "/wow6432node" part after the "hkey_local_machine/software/" entry, close notepad and save the file, and then just double click on it and import it back into the registry.
